Unverified Commit f71e09a7 authored by Aleksana's avatar Aleksana Committed by GitHub
Browse files

tlp: remove all `/usr/` prefixes to fix install dirs (#350268)

parents ca918975 444f7cd7
Loading
Loading
Loading
Loading
+4 −10
Original line number Diff line number Diff line
@@ -39,6 +39,10 @@
    ./patches/0002-reintroduce-tlp-sleep-service.patch
  ];

  postPatch = ''
    substituteInPlace Makefile --replace-fail ' ?= /usr/' ' ?= /'
  '';

  buildInputs = [ perl ];
  nativeBuildInputs = [ makeWrapper ];

@@ -55,16 +59,6 @@
    "TLP_WITH_SYSTEMD=1"

    "DESTDIR=${placeholder "out"}"
    "TLP_BATD=/share/tlp/bat.d"
    "TLP_BIN=/bin"
    "TLP_CONFDEF=/share/tlp/defaults.conf"
    "TLP_CONFREN=/share/tlp/rename.conf"
    "TLP_FLIB=/share/tlp/func.d"
    "TLP_MAN=/share/man"
    "TLP_META=/share/metainfo"
    "TLP_SBIN=/sbin"
    "TLP_SHCPL=/share/bash-completion/completions"
    "TLP_TLIB=/share/tlp"
  ];

  installTargets = [ "install-tlp" "install-man" ]